          In our fast-paced modern world, we all seek a "spiritual sanctuary"—a quiet corner where the soul can rest Today, I’m taking you into a world of micro-wonders: the 1:12 Scale Chinese Ancient Style Miniature Diorama—"The Study of Ancient Insights" (知古小斋). This is more than just a display piece; it is a deep dialogue between Eastern aesthetics and the art of hand-crafting. ⛩️ The Inspiration: A Scholar’s Escape The "Study of Ancient Insights" is rooted in the literati culture of the Ming and Qing Dynasties. In ancient China, a study was not just a place for ink and books; it was a private sanctuary for scholars to cultivate their character and "escape" into nature and history. The design features classic Suzhou-style architectural elements. The grey-tiled flying eaves and intricate lattice windows are not just boundaries of space—they are masters of light and shadow. When sunlight filters through the "Wan-zi" (swastika) patterns and casts shadows on the stone floor, the atmosphere of ancient serenity is instantly captured. 🎨 Craftsmanship: Reviving Timeless Chinese Elements The magic of this piece lies in its extreme dedication to authentic Chinese cultural symbols: The Backbone of Ming-style Furniture: The centerpiece desk and chair recreate the "simple yet profound" lines of Ming furniture. The iconic Horseshoe Chair (Quanyi) features a rounded back that perfectly illustrates the Chinese philosophical concept of "Tian Yuan Di Fang"—the Round Heaven and the Square Earth. The Elegance of Scholar's Objects: Tiny hand-painted scrolls and delicate porcelain vases sit upon the desk, making it feel as if the master of the house has just stepped out for a moment, leaving the scent of ink behind. Landscape Imagery: The landscape scroll on the back wall echoes the view through the open windows, achieving the poetic ideal of "life inside, scenery outside." 🛠️ 100% DIY: Become Your Own "Miniature Architect"Unlike many mass-produced, pre-built models, every component of the "Study of Ancient Insights" is designed for DIY assembly.                       Our Roots: From Finished Collectibles to DIY Exploration Over the past two years, we have rolled out a series of DIY products. Due to shipping costs, we ultimately chose to test them only in the US market. We are very grateful to our customers, as our products have received quite positive feedback. We tried selling them on Amazon, Temu, and our official website, and they essentially sold out. This prompted us to decide this year to upgrade and transform this DIY product line. For the first time, we attempted to make our DIY series products using steel molds. This attempt took significantly more time than we anticipated, and we invested over $50,000. However, the products still haven't materialized to this day. It has to be said that this is a significant setback. We are questioning whether mass-producing the DIY series is the right choice. We, Miniento, initially entered this market by making dollhouses and finished miniature furniture. We saw many customers struggling because they lacked sufficiently exquisite miniature scenes and props to decorate their dolls, so we chose the niche of high-precision miniature scenes and furniture. Initially, we sold finished products, not the DIY series. As the market gradually shrank, the price of our finished goods became relatively high – because finished products require a lot of manual labor. We are not a sweatshop; we fully respect the work and contributions of our team members. Starting last year, we attempted sales in the US but hesitated to sell finished furniture due to concerns about shipping damage. Nevertheless, many customers contacted us through Facebook and purchased some finished furniture. To these customers, we once again express our gratitude for their trust. After all, given the relatively high value of the goods, they were willing to place their faith in us unconditionally. Fortunately, these orders encountered no major issues during shipping, only some minor, unavoidable bumps. We also thank them for their tolerance and understanding – we promptly followed up and resolved any concerns. We have not given up on stocking finished furniture in the US market. Preparations are ongoing, and we are continuously designing new packaging.

                        Based on our observations and communication with consumers, we have found that many customers perceive the finished prices of miniature furniture to be somewhat high. There are several factors contributing to the high prices. Firstly, these products require a significant amount of time for manual craftsmanship, but the production volume is limited, which is inherent to this type of product. Secondly, many exceptional pieces are created by artists driven by their passion, and to acquire such products, consumers often need to pay a premium above the market value to capture the attention of the creators. Thirdly, and most importantly, the market price of these products has significantly increased due to a shortage in supply.   As a company committed to deepening our presence in this industry, Miniento has introduced a series of miniature DIY material kits in response to the current issue. These products significantly save time in the production of highly detailed components for crafting authentic miniature furniture. Through the utilization of 3D printing technology, we have created molds with high precision to ensure the preservation of intricate details found in real furniture. Furthermore, we provide detailed DIY tutorials to ensure that individuals, regardless of their experience, can achieve satisfying results using our kits.
